2026 Chairman Keith Burton at the Helm of Independence Bowl Foundation after Annual Membership Meeting

SHREVEPORT, La. (March 17, 2026) – As the Radiance Technologies Independence Bowl celebrates its 50th anniversary this year, 2026 Chairman Keith Burton will lead the Independence Bowl Foundation.
Burton, officially sworn in at the 2026 Annual Membership Meeting on Thursday, March 12 at Pierremont Oaks Tennis Club, takes the reins from 2025 Chairwoman, Sarah Giglio.
“It is a tremendous honor to serve as Chairman of the Independence Bowl Foundation during such a special year. The 50th anniversary is an opportunity not only to celebrate the incredible legacy built over five decades, but also to position the Independence Bowl for an even stronger future,” said Burton. “I look forward to working alongside our outstanding staff, volunteers, and Foundation members to deliver another great bowl experience for our community and college football fans.”
The entire 2026 Executive Committee and Board of Directors slate was voted in at the Annual Membership Meeting – a slate that includes some of Shreveport-Bossier City’s most influential leaders and citizens.
Keith Burton serves as Superintendent of Caddo Parish Public Schools, where he leads one of Louisiana’s largest school systems and works closely with educators, community leaders, and business partners to improve educational outcomes and expand opportunities for students. Prior to becoming superintendent, Burton served the district in several leadership roles, including Chief Academic Officer and school principal, and has spent more than three decades in education.
A longtime resident of the Shreveport-Bossier area, Burton has been actively involved in numerous civic, nonprofit, and community organizations. His service includes leadership roles with the Committee of 100, the Rotary Club of Shreveport, the Norwela Council of the Boy Scouts of America, Community in Schools/Volunteers of America (CIS-VOA), and the Shreveport-Bossier Military Affairs Council.
Burton has been a member of the Independence Bowl Foundation for many years and currently serves on its Board of Directors, Executive Committee and Selection Committee. As Chairman for the 2026 game, he will help lead the organization during the Bowl’s milestone 50th anniversary season, working alongside staff, volunteers, and board leadership to strengthen conference relationships, enhance the bowl experience for participating teams and fans, and position the Independence Bowl for continued success in the evolving landscape of college football.
He and his wife, Tina, have three children — Ryan, Will, and Anna Kate — all of whom live in the Shreveport-Bossier community with their spouses.
Below is the 13-member Independence Bowl Foundation Executive Committee for 2026-27:
- Chairman: Keith Burton (Caddo Parish Public Schools)
- Vice-Chairman: Greg Lott (Progressive Bank)
- 1st Vice-Chairman: Tim Wilhite (Wilhite Electric)
- 2nd Vice-Chairman: Doug Bland (Shelter Insurance – Bland Agency, Inc.)
- Treasurer: Jayce Simpson (Community Bank of Louisiana)
- Secretary: John David Person (WIELAND)
- Immediate Past Chairwoman: Sarah Giglio (Gilmer & Giglio)
- Three-Year Term: Crystal Wooldridge (Raymond James)
- Three-Year Term: Bert Schmale (Home Federal Bank)
- Two-Year Term: Tyler Williams (Edward Jones)
- Two-Year Term: Victor Mainiero (Caddo Parish Public Schools)
- One-Year Term: Taylor Jamison (NextEra Energy Resources)
- One-Year Term: Lee Holmes (U.S. Air Force Reserve)
- Title Sponsor Ex-Officio: Jerry Skievaski (Radiance Technologies)
Sixteen Three-Year Term members of the Independence Bowl Foundation Board of Directors were voted in at the meeting, while the Two-Year and One-Year Term members rolled into their respective board slots. There are also 32 Life Directors on the board. The Independence Bowl Foundation has 89 active members of the Board of Directors, including nine Ex-Officio members.
